As we target 4x growth over the next four years, you'll have unprecedented opportunities to take on new challenges, develop cutting-edge skills, and grow your career across our expanding global operations.Join our team of innovators and help shape the future of sustainable data centers while building a career without boundaries.We are seeking a dynamic, experienced Compliance Manager to implement our compliance framework across North American operations. In this role, you will be responsible for ensuring adherence to regulatory and client requirements and driving operational excellence across all North American Serverfarm sites. This is a hands-on management position that requires up to date expertise in regulatory compliance across a series of standards including; SOC, PCI, HiPPA, ISO 9001/14001/27001/50001 and others. You will work cross-functionally with legal, IT, HR, operations, and Global Compliance teams to develop and maintain a robust compliance program that supports business growth whilst mitigating risks.Key AccountabilitiesMonitor and assess statutory developments, ensuring Serverfarm remains compliant with all applicable lawsEnsure adherence to all relevant regulatory compliance requirements, including datacenter specific standards, IT/security, energy efficiency, and federal/state considerationsEnsure we meet compliance obligations stipulated within client contractsCollaborate with senior leadership to align compliance strategies with business objectives and embed compliance best practices into daily operationsDevelop and implement operational compliance strategies to identify, assess, and mitigate risksDevelop, implement and maintain policies, procedures, and controls to support compliance and operational integrityParticipate in risk assessments and internal control reviews, ensuring timely reporting to key stakeholdersManage and organise internal and external audits, ensuring regulatory and industry standards are metDocument compliance breaches, ensuring prompt investigation, remediation, and reportingAct as a key compliance representative in client engagements, addressing compliance-related inquiries, due diligence processes, and contractual obligationsAct as a key liaison with regulators, auditors, and internal leadership, ensuring transparency and adherence to regulatory requirementsLead compliance training initiatives to educate teams on regulatory obligations, ethical standards, and best practicesDrive Change Management initiatives ensuring smooth transitions when implementing regulatory updates and policy changesPromote and maintain the core Values of ServerfarmMinimum QualificationsBachelor’s degree or Master's degree or relevant certifications8+ years of experience in regulatory compliance, operational risk management, or a related field, with at least3+ years leading a compliance function, team, or departmentStrong knowledge of federal and state regulations including Data PrivacyExpertise in industry accreditations and frameworks, preferably datacenter related. Essential: ISO, SOC, PCI DSS, HIPAA, CCPA, CPRA. Advantageous: NIS2, DORA, GDPR, CSRDProven ability to develop and implement compliance frameworks and policies that align with business operationsExperience managing compliance audits and regulatory examinationsStrong client engagement skills, with the ability to communicate compliance requirements effectivelyAwareness of global ESG initiativesAbility to work independently and remotely collaborate across multiple departments, in different time zonesExcellent written and verbal communication skillsAbility to travel within North America, with some periods working away from homeServerfarm is committed to providing an equal opportunity workplace and offers paid time off, paid holidays, 401k and FULL coverage medical, dental and vision.
